Key Features to Look For

When searching for punk rock covers, there are key things to consider. These features make the songs stand out.

  • Energy and Attitude: Punk rock is all about energy! The cover needs to have a lot of it. Look for songs with fast tempos and a rebellious attitude. The band should sound like they mean it.
  • Unique Twist: A good cover doesn’t just copy the original. It adds something new. Does the band change the tempo? Do they change the instruments? Do they change the vocals? Listen for a fresh take on the song.
  • Clear Production: You want to hear the music! The recording quality matters. The instruments and vocals should sound clear. Avoid songs that sound muffled or poorly recorded.
  • Song Selection: Does the album or playlist cover a variety of genres? Does the band select covers that fit the punk rock style? Check if the band picked good songs.
